dwell

/ˈdwel/

Middle English, from Old English dwellan to go astray, hinder; akin to Old High German twellen to tarry

verb

  1. to remain for a time

  2. to live as a resident

  3. exist, lie

dwell in the hallway

phrasal verb

  1. to think or talk about (something) for a long time

There is no need to dwell on the past.
